🎶 VibeFusion is a React-based music analytics and recommendation platform that connects to the Spotify API to provide users with detailed insights into their listening habits, smart music recommendations, and personalized DJ tools. The aim of VibeFusion is to provide a continuous insight into the users’ musical preferences, extending beyond the summary offered by Spotify Wrapped, data that is available to the user year round.
- Discover Your Music DNA: Analyze your top tracks, favorite artists, preferred genres, and even the musical keys and moods that dominate your playlists.
- Smart Recommendations: Get music suggestions tailored to your tastes using VibeFusion's intelligent algorithm.
- DJ Hub: Create customized playlists based on your preferences such as genre, mood, tempo, popularity, and more.
- Detailed Stats: Dive deeper into your listening habits with visual representations of your favorite genres, tracks, artists, and other metrics like BPM and mood.

Frontend: The frontend is developed using React. The project leverages React Bootstrap, which integrates Bootstrap components seamlessly with React. The application also utilizes Recharts for creating dynamic and customizable data visualizations, and AOS (Animate On Scroll) to add smooth animations as elements enter the viewport. This combination results in a responsive, interactive, and visually engaging user experience.
-
Backend: The backend is built with Express.js, handling API requests, user sessions, and interactions with the Spotify API. It uses the
spotify-web-api-node
wrapper to simplify communication with Spotify's services. Additionally,axios
is employed for making HTTP requests, whilecors
ensures that the frontend and backend can communicate seamlessly across different domains.

The backend server provides several API endpoints for interacting with Spotify's services:
GET /login
- Initiates Spotify OAuth flow for user authentication.
GET /callback
- Handles the OAuth callback from Spotify after user authentication and exchanges the authorization code for access and refresh tokens.
GET /me
- Retrieves basic information about the authenticated user.
GET /top-tracks
- Retrieves the user's top tracks. Accepts an optional query parameter
term
(short_term
,medium_term
,long_term
) to specify the time range.
- Retrieves the user's top tracks. Accepts an optional query parameter
GET /top-artists
- Retrieves the user's top artists. Accepts an optional query parameter
term
(short_term
,medium_term
,long_term
) to specify the time range.
- Retrieves the user's top artists. Accepts an optional query parameter
GET /search
- Searches for tracks based on a query parameter
q
(the search term).
- Searches for tracks based on a query parameter
GET /detailed-stats
- Retrieves detailed statistics for the user's top 20 tracks, including tempo, key, and other audio features.
POST /dj
Generates song recommendations based on user-selected criteria such as genre, mood, tempo, popularity, and danceability.GET /recommendations
- Fetches song recommendations based on the user's top tracks and artists.
POST /create-playlist
- Creates a new playlist in the user's Spotify account with a given set of track URIs.
GET /top-genres
- Retrieves the user's top genres based on their listening habits.
GET /danceability
- Finds and returns the most danceable track from the user's top tracks.
GET /mood
- Calculates and returns the average mood (valence) of the user's top tracks.
- Authentication: The app requires users to authenticate with their Spotify account. Upon successful authentication, users can access personalized features like top tracks, top artists, and smart recommendations.
- Rate Limiting: Spotify's API has rate limits. The application includes error handling for situations where these limits are exceeded, prompting users to retry after a specified time.
